Emerging Trends in the evTOL Personal Air Vehicle Market
The evTOL personal air vehicle market is experiencing dynamic changes as technological, economic, and regulatory advancements are creating new opportunities and challenges. These developments are not only transforming transportation in urban areas but are also influencing the wider aviation and mobility industries. Below are five key trends shaping the future of the evTOL market.
• Urban Air Mobility (UAM) Expansion: Urban air mobility, which is the use of evTOLs for urban transportation, is growing rapidly. As cities become more congested, evTOLs offer a viable solution to reduce traffic congestion by flying over traffic. Companies are working on vehicles capable of carrying passengers or freight on short trips, such as air taxis. This trend is reshaping the transportation landscape, promising a more efficient way to navigate crowded cities. UAM is expected to be a key player in cities across the globe, especially in areas of high population density.
• Government Regulations And Certification: As evTOL technology continues to advance, governments and regulatory bodies are establishing new rules for certification and integration into existing airspace. The FAA in the U.S., EASA in Europe, and other aviation authorities are working on standards to ensure safety and reliability. These regulations are vital for the mass availability of evTOLs and to make it possible for these vehicles to safely fly in urban areas. Regulatory developments will dictate the rate at which evTOLs are coming out, making this an important trend for the sectorÄX%$%Xs growth.
• Electric Propulsion And Sustainability: A key trend in the evTOL market is the development of electric propulsion systems, which are at the core of the technology’s environmental appeal. These electric engines produce zero emissions, making evTOLs an attractive alternative to traditional fossil-fuel-powered transportation. Companies are working to improve battery technology and energy efficiency to extend flight ranges and reduce operational costs. The push for sustainability is influencing the development of the market, as environmental concerns become increasingly important in the design and operation of new transportation systems.
• Integration With Autonomous Technologies: Many evTOL manufacturers are now integrating autonomous flight technologies into their vehicles. Autonomous evTOLs would decrease the dependency on human pilots, which may decrease operational costs and increase safety as human errors would be minimized. With advances in artificial intelligence, machine learning, and sensor technologies, the concept of autonomous evTOLs is not just a vision but a reality. This could lead to major disruptions in the aviation industry and facilitate more efficient air mobility and provide opportunities for on-demand services in urban areas.
• Infrastructure Development For evTOLs: A key trend driving the evTOL market is the development of infrastructure, such as vertiports, charging stations, and air traffic management systems. Specialized facilities are needed to support the operation of evTOLs in urban areas. Cities and private companies are working on building a network of vertiports, while governments are considering how to integrate evTOLs into existing transportation networks. The successful development of these infrastructure elements is important for the scalability of the evTOL market.

Recent Development in the evTOL Personal Air Vehicle Market
The evTOL personal air vehicle market has seen significant progress in the last few years, with several countries and companies contributing to the advancements in this space. Technological breakthroughs, increased investments, and regulatory progress are driving the sector toward commercialization. Here are five key developments that are shaping the marketÄX%$%Xs growth and future potential.
• Technological Advancements in evTOL Aircraft: Technological innovations in the design of evTOL aircraft will be a great enabler in their commercialization. Manufacturers are working on propulsion systems that would be more efficient, better battery technologies, and lightweight materials for better performance. These innovations will help reduce operational costs for evTOLs and increase range, making urban air mobility feasible. Improvements in safety features are also aimed at making the evTOLs operate dependably in densely populated urban areas.
• Investment and Partnerships: Increased investment and strategic partnerships are driving the growth of the evTOL market. Venture capital firms, aerospace companies, and even government-backed entities are investing heavily in companies like Joby Aviation, Lilium, and Volocopter. These investments enable the development of prototypes, testing, and certification processes. In fact, manufacturers of evTOLs must partner with aviation authorities to develop the regulatory framework required for safe commercial operations.
• Regulatory Frameworks for Urban Air Mobility: The development of regulatory frameworks is an important step in the integration of evTOLs into existing transportation systems. Aviation authorities, such as the FAA and EASA, are developing new rules and certifications for evTOLs to ensure their safe operation in urban environments. These frameworks are important to the large-scale adoption of evTOLs, addressing concerns around airspace integration, safety, and infrastructure. The rate at which these regulations are being developed will have a big influence on the growth rate of the market.
• Ecosystem for Urban Air Mobility Development: Developing the whole ecosystem of urban air mobility is one of the significant drivers of the evTOL market. This encompasses construction of vertiports for takeoff and landing of the evTOL, along with air traffic management systems meant for efficient route planning. The development of this infrastructure is being carried out by both private companies and governments in a collaborative effort to make the scaling of evTOLs possible. Expanding this ecosystem will allow for the safe and efficient operation of evTOLs in dense urban environments.
• Collaborations and International Expansion: International collaborations between companies and governments are driving evTOL market expansion. For example, German-based Volocopter has partnered with Dubai’s government to create an evTOL air taxi service, and American companies like Joby Aviation are working on expanding their operations internationally. These collaborations are key to developing a global market for evTOLs, as they enable cross-border integration of technology, regulations, and infrastructure. This trend will play a major role in the global commercialization of evTOLs.

Strategic Growth Opportunities in the evTOL Personal Air Vehicle Market
The evTOL personal air vehicle market offers multiple growth opportunities across various applications. As urban air mobility gains traction, these opportunities are being driven by advancements in technology, regulatory progress, and infrastructure development. Below are five key growth opportunities within the evTOL market.
• Urban Air Mobility (UAM) Services: The growth of urban air mobility services is one major opportunity for the evTOL market. Companies are working towards developing air taxi services that can provide fast, efficient, and eco-friendly transportation in densely populated urban areas. As traffic congestion continues to worsen in major cities, the pressure on ground-based transportation systems may be reduced by the adoption of evTOLs. Urban air mobility services can be a revolutionary shift in the mode of commuting and can be the sustainable alternative for traditional modes of transport.
• Cargo transport and delivery services: The other area of potential for evTOLs is cargo transport and delivery services. Companies are researching the use of evTOLs for small parcel deliveries, especially in urban environments where traditional vehicles face challenges due to traffic congestion. This application is likely to be one of the first widespread uses of evTOLs. Faster, cost-effective deliveries, especially in congested areas, are exciting opportunities for companies in logistics and transportation.
• Government and Military Applications: Governments and military organizations are researching the use of evTOLs for surveillance, search and rescue missions, and troop transport. evTOLs offer a lot of advantages in terms of agility, speed, and the ability to take off and land vertically. The potential for military-grade evTOLs to operate in challenging environments and deliver personnel or supplies rapidly is driving growth in this application.
• Tourism and Leisure Applications: The tourism and leisure is one significant application that can be predicted for evTOL. Companies are looking at offering scenic flights, aerial tours, and other leisure services to high-value customers who would want experience unique styles of traveling. This service is expected to boom in locations that are rich in tourism—beach locations or mountainous resorts where the air routes taken by an evTOL present a valuable scenic view to the tourists while offering fast transportation.
• Maintenance and Support Services: With a growing fleet of evTOLs, the demand for maintenance and support services will increase. Companies will need a network of service providers to maintain the airworthiness of the vehicles, carry out regular inspections, and ensure that safety standards are not compromised. This is an area of significant opportunity for companies specializing in aircraft MRO services.

evTOL Personal Air Vehicle Market Driver and Challenges
The current drivers and challenges that will shape the evTOL personal air vehicle market are technological developments, economic factors, and regulatory issues. An understanding of these key drivers and challenges is essential to the success of the future market. Below, we discuss the main factors influencing the development and growth of the evTOL market.
The factors responsible for driving the evtol personal air vehicle market include:
1. Technological Advancements in evTOL Design: Technological innovation is the major driver of the evTOL market. Commercial evTOLs are centered on new designs that focus on efficiency, safety, and low environmental impact. This includes improvements in propulsion technology, lightweight materials, and battery efficiency. Continuous improvement in these technologies is making evTOLs more viable and affordable for urban mobility.
2. Government Investment and Regulatory Support: World governments have been inquiring about investing in the evTOL technology and providing regulatory frameworks for its development. Countries such as the United States, China, and Germany make policies that help to facilitate certification and operation of evTOLs. The government support and finance speed up research and development, making it easier to get evTOLs to market.
3. Environmental Concerns and Sustainability: As climate change concerns grow, the demand for sustainable transportation options has risen. evTOLs, with their electric propulsion systems, offer a cleaner alternative to traditional vehicles. This environmental appeal is driving the market, as cities look for ways to reduce emissions and traffic congestion. The shift toward greener transportation options is influencing the broader adoption of evTOL technology.
4. Urbanization and Traffic Congestion: Urbanization is happening fast, and so is the rate of traffic congestion. Alternative means of transportation have become a pressing need. This is where the urban air mobility sector, consisting of evTOLs, comes into the picture. As people are expecting faster and more direct travel inside cities, they are interested in evTOL technology.
5. Rising Investment in Aviation and Aerospace: Venture capital, aviation companies, and government-backed agencies are investing heavily in the development of evTOLs. The influx of funding is allowing for the creation of prototypes, research into new technologies, and establishment of the necessary infrastructure. As more money is invested into the sector, the speed at which evTOLs can be commercialized increases.
Challenges in the evtol personal air vehicle market are:
1. High Development Costs: The development of evTOLs involves significant costs in terms of research, technology development, and certification. Many companies in the market are still in the early stages of development and face financial barriers in bringing their products to market. Securing funding to cover these costs remains one of the largest challenges for the industry.
2. Regulatory and Certification Hurdles: A huge challenge for the manufacturers of evTOL is regulatory approval. The FAA, EASA, and other aviation bodies are still working on clear guidelines for the operation of evTOLs. The certification process for evTOLs is complex and time-consuming, which may delay the commercialization of these vehicles.
3. Infrastructure Development: The infrastructure to be developed for the support of evTOLs, such as vertiports and air traffic management systems, is a big challenge. In the absence of such infrastructure, the mass-scale adoption of evTOLs will be quite challenging. Collaboration between governments and private companies must be ensured for the development of the required facilities and efficient working of urban air mobility systems.

Country Wise Outlook for the evTOL Personal Air Vehicle Market
The evTOL personal air vehicle market has experienced massive growth and innovation, with many countries significantly working on these future vehicles. With promises of faster, more environment-friendly, and efficient transportation for cities, significant investments and research have been witnessed in this field. Among the leading nations include the United States, China, Germany, India, and Japan. These vehicles will revolutionize personal transportation, bringing new solutions for urban air mobility (UAM) while responding to growing congestion and environmental concerns.
• United States: The United States is a leader in the evTOL market, with many companies that are making tremendous strides. Companies such as Joby Aviation, Archer Aviation, and Lilium are leading the charge with prototypes and plans for certification of their vehicles. In addition, the FAA in the U.S. has been highly energetic in providing a regulatory framework on the integration of evTOLs safely within the airspaces. There are possibilities in shaping urban mobility and especially urban conurbationsÄX%$%X mobility using the development of evTOLs. As in the United States, market growth is the significant driver behind infrastructure investment supporting the evTOLs. Those include vertiports, the air traffic management system.
• China: China has been swiftly advancing in the evTOL space, as companies like EHang and Xpeng Aero continue to develop and test personal air vehicles. Already, EHang has successfully held trial flights with its autonomous evTOL aircraft, and such innovations are favored by the government of China. The country is replete with infrastructure, like heavy traffic-ridden urban centers, making it a prime target for evTOLs. The country is focusing on creating the regulatory environment for urban air mobility. The Chinese market will experience high demand due to the rapid pace of urbanization and technological adoption.
• Germany: Germany is one of the several countries which has made significant progress in the evTOL market, with the focus areas including precision engineering and sustainability. Companies such as Lilium and Volocopter are working on commercial evTOL vehicles for urban air mobility. Germany has a friendly regulatory environment for evTOL innovation. The European Union Aviation Safety Agency is working to create a framework for evTOL certification. The German government is investing in infrastructure, such as designated vertiports and advanced air traffic management systems. GermanyÄX%$%Xs robust manufacturing base and commitment to green technologies are going to be crucial factors in its rise in the evTOL market.
• India: IndiaÄX%$%Xs evTOL market is still in the nascent stages, but holds great promise since the country has been rapidly urbanizing and struggling with infrastructure challenges. Companies like Vahana India and Urban Aeronautics are actively exploring evTOL technology in air taxis and freight delivery. The Indian government is supportive of new transportation technologies, and IndiaÄX%$%Xs burgeoning tech sector could help drive innovation in the space. While regulatory frameworks and infrastructure are yet to be built, the very dense urbanization and air pollution problems of this country make the case for a solution in evTOL for future sustainable efficient urban air mobility.
• Japan: Japan has taken active participation and development of the evTOL. Companies SkyDrive and Cartivator were developing personal air vehicles for air mobility in an urban environment. Japan’s high-tech industry and expertise in robotics make it an ideal environment for evTOL development. The Japanese government is working on creating the necessary infrastructure for these vehicles, including vertiports and air traffic management systems. Japan’s population density and traffic congestion in major cities like Tokyo make evTOLs a promising solution for the country’s transportation challenges. This market development is accelerated with the government collaborating with private companies.
